The Top Ten Longest Running Sitcoms
pre-80's shows excluded
| # | Name | |
| 1. | The Simpsons | 20 seasons |
| 2. | King of the Hill | 13 seasons (244+ episodes) |
| 3. | South Park | 13 seasons (185+ episodes) |
| 4. | Frasier | 11 seasons (264 episodes) |
| 5. | Married...With Children | 11 seasons (259 episodes) |
| 6. | Murphy Brown | 10 seasons (247 episodes) |
| 7. | Friends | 10 seasons (238 epsiodes) |
| 8. | The Love Boat | 9 seasons (245 episodes) |
| 9. | The Drew Carey Show | 9 seasons (233 episodes) |
| 10. | Roseanne | 9 seasons (222 episodes) |
